Back-to-basics Mozart and Beethoven with Fabio Luisi and the Dallas Symphony

«Of course, Mozart’s performances of his own symphonies never happened in halls remotely as large as Dallas’ 2,000-seat Meyerson Symphony Center. And Luisi was onto something by approaching the Jupiter as more than “just” a symphony. It’s actually a pretty dramatic piece, and Luisi’s rather operatic approach contrasted bold statements and emphases with whispered delicacies. Phrases great and small were lovingly tapered and directed. The finale was exhilarating.»

Scott Cantrell
